如何在 VTP 服务器和客户端之间同步 MD5 摘要?

网络工程 思科 转变 虚拟机
2021-07-12 05:39:31

跟进此问答

根据其中一个答案,通过在 VTP 客户端和服务器之间同步用户名、密码和域,然后在 VTP 服务器上执行 VLAN 更改以对齐客户端上的 MD5 摘要,应该可以解决 MD5 摘要不匹配问题。

但是,在执行这些步骤后,sh vtp st在 VTP Server 和 Client 上都执行后,这两者之间的 MD5 摘要之间仍然存在差异,这避免了 VTP Client 上的 VLAN 数据库与 VTP Server 之一同步。

一旦在 VTP 服务器上更改了 VLAN 的名称,MD5 摘要也将更改。但是,客户端上的 MD5 摘要保持不变,并显示以下消息:

*** MD5 digest checksum mismatch on trunk: Po1 ***

2个回答

Cisco Learning Network 上检查此线程并随后对 VTP 客户端和服务器执行一些检查后,例如:

sh vtp st
sh vtp password
sh int trunk

看起来domain是相同的,并且端口通道处于中继模式。但是,由于某种原因,VTP 密码之间存在差异。

通过在 VTP 服务器上执行vtp password hello和更改 VLAN 的名称 ( conf t&& vl X&& name helloworld)同步 VTP 客户端和服务器上的密码后,MD5 摘要变得相同

Switch#sh vtp st
VTP Version capable             : 1 to 3
VTP version running             : 1
VTP Domain Name                 : domain
VTP Pruning Mode                : Enabled
VTP Traps Generation            : Disabled
Device ID                       : X.Y.Z
Configuration last modified by X at Y Z

Feature VLAN:
--------------
VTP Operating Mode                : Client
Maximum VLANs supported locally   : 1005
Number of existing VLANs          : 6
Configuration Revision            : 6
MD5 digest                        : 0xfc 0x5e 0x03 0x8d 0x38 0xa5 0x70 0x32 
                                    0x08 0x54 0x41 0xe7 0xfe 0x70 0x10 0xb0

并且 VLAN 列表随后同步。

Switch>sh vl

VLAN Name                             Status    Ports
---- -------------------------------- --------- -------------------------------
1    default                          active    Gi0/1, Gi0/2, Gi0/3, Gi0/4
                                                Gi0/5, Gi0/6, Gi0/7, Gi0/8
                                                Gi0/9, Gi0/10, Gi0/11, Gi0/12
                                                Gi0/13, Gi0/14, Gi0/15, Gi0/16
                                                Gi0/17, Gi0/18, Gi0/19, Gi0/20
                                                Gi0/21, Gi0/22, Gi0/23, Gi0/24
                                                Gi0/25, Gi0/26, Gi0/27, Gi0/28
                                                Gi0/29, Gi0/30, Gi0/31, Gi0/32
                                                Gi0/33, Gi0/34, Gi0/35, Gi0/36
                                                Gi0/37, Gi0/38, Gi0/39, Gi0/40
                                                Gi0/41, Gi0/42, Gi0/43, Gi0/44
100  helloworld                       active

再创建一个 vlan(您可以稍后将其删除),它应该可以解决您的问题

add vlan 999
exit 
no vlan 999